Jogging around Juvigny-Val-D'Andaine offers a variety of running experiences through the region's diverse landscape. The area features a mix of woodlands, open fields, and tranquil ponds, providing varied terrain for runners. Routes often incorporate natural water features and offer views of the surrounding countryside. The region's topography includes gentle undulations, making it suitable for different fitness levels.

Best jogging routes around Juvigny-Val-D'Andaine

  • The most popular jogging route is Étang de la Forge – Étang des Brisettes loop from Bagnoles-de-l'Orne-Normandie, a 7.7 miles (12.4 km) trail that takes 1 hour 30 minutes to complete. This moderate route circles scenic ponds and offers a refreshing run through natural surroundings.
  • Another top favourite among local runners is Bonvouloir Tower – Ermitage Pond loop from Juvigny Val d'Andaine, a difficult 13.2 miles (21.3 km) path. This route combines historical interest with natural beauty, passing by the Bonvouloir Tower and Ermitage Pond.
  • Local runners also love the Running loop from Rives-d'Andaine, a 3.8 miles (6.2 km) trail leading through varied local scenery, often completed in about 40 minutes.

The town hall is located in the castle of La Roche Bagnoles. The chateau is set in a magnificent arboretum containing over 150 varieties of trees which was established in 1859.

At the heart of the Andaine forest is a 12th century hermitage where the monks of Lonlay Abbey have set up a place of prayer. The lake bears the name of this hermitage. It is an oasis of water in a desert of trees.

This natural Armorican sandstone belvedere offers a very pretty view of Bagnoles-de-l'Orne. At your feet you see an impressive scree stand.
